+    /**
+     * Returns a constant time offset that is used to normalize the time values
+     * to a range of 0..53 bits to avoid loss of precision when converting
+     * long <-> double.
+     *
+     * Time values are stored in TMF as long values. The SWT chart library
+     * uses values of type double (on x and y axis). To avoid loss of
+     * precision when converting long <-> double the values need to fit
+     * within 53 bits.
+     *
+     * Subtract the offset when using time values provided externally for
+     * internal usage in SWT chart. Add the offset when using time values
+     * provided by SWT chart (e.g. for display purposes) and when broadcasting
+     * them externally (e.g. time synchronization signals).
+     *
+     * For example the offset can be calculated as the time of the first
+     * time value in the current time range to be displayed in the chart.
+     * Add +1 to avoid 0 when using logarithmic scale.
+     *
+     * t0=10000, t2=20000, tn=N -> timeOffset=t0-1
+     * -> t0'=1, t1'=10001, tn'=N-timeOffset
+     *
+     * where t0 ... tn are times used externally and t0' ... tn' are times
+     * used internally by the SWT chart.
+     *
+     * @return the time offset
+     */
+    long getTimeOffset();
